How Much Do Property Surveying Services Owners Typically Earn?

Property Surveying Services owners generally earn between $60,000 and $130,000 annually, depending on factors such as project volume and regional market demand. This earning range is influenced by the mix of residential versus commercial projects and the efficiency in managing operational costs. With a compensation structure that includes a fixed draw and performance-based bonuses, owners in high-growth areas can see a 10-20% income boost. How Do Property Surveying Services Profit Margins Impact Owner Income??

Understanding profit margins is crucial when assessing property surveying owner income. Surveying profit margins have a direct impact on how much earnings remain after expenses. For instance, Property Surveying Services often show gross margins between 15% and 30%, with net margins typically falling in the 5-15% range. How Do Property Surveying Services Owners Pay Themselves?

Property Surveying Services owners commonly adopt a mixed compensation model that balances a base salary with profit distributions from net earnings. This approach allows owners to secure steady income while tapping into the benefits of strong Surveying Profit Margins. Many owners draw between 40-60% of profits as personal salary, ensuring funds remain for business reinvestment.
